Meet Meridith Bergquist, MS, CCLS
Meridith Bergquist, M.S., CCLS has been a Certified Child Life Specialist for 15 years, dedicating most of her career as a Child Life Specialist in the Emergency Department. With an undergraduate degree from Minnesota State University, Mankato and a Master’s in Child Development with a concentration in Child Life Leadership and Advocacy from the Erikson Institute; she has always demonstrated passion about serving the next generation of Child Life Specialists.
Meridith continues to be an advocate for continued growth and evolvement of the Child Life profession. She is a lifelong learner and strives to be an educator not only for students, but for other healthcare providers. As a presenter at the Midwest Child Life Conference, her expertise and dedication to students, providers, and Child Life is unwavering. Through her time supporting children and families in emergent procedures, emotional distress, and bereavement; she saw a need to bring students into the picture. She strongly believes that some of the hardest moments and lessons of the Child Life profession can only be taught through experience. Thus, she created and implemented a Minnesota-based practicum program for students to foster skills of their own while observing a variety of clinical experiences. She is proud to say this program continues to evolve and support students in the ever-changing world of child life.
